Deep Ruby with aromas of berries, flowers and earthy spice. On the palate rich cherry, plum, cranberry and a touch of raspberry. Very smooth tannins, balanced well with acidity, nice mouth feel, with the right amount of oak. This medium body Pinot finished with good length ending with mineral spice. Should age well.
